Transaction 535abf42a6103f6f18c53c4e58ccd177c01f5c6228514561f85b540aa0399adb

9 Input
1 Outputs
  • 535abf42a6103f6f18c53c4e58ccd177c01f5c6228514561f85b540aa0399adb:0
  • value  279602642
    address  12xjTvg1aqK9Jc46N4cxTLiKnCWnDwD4S9